Well Institute presents...
THEATER AT LUNCHTIME in the Gerding Theater mezzanine-- Staged Reading of Survivors and Thrivers, as part of the Fertile Ground Festival. Never-before-seen writings from elders all over Portland, professionally performed for your delight and amazement!  Suvivors and Thrivers is a staged reading of stories, creative non-fiction, memoir pieces and poetry written by elders living in Potland, bring their varied, colorful lives and memories together in one performance so that we can all experience their lives, wisdom and courage.  This event takes place at 12.30pm at 128 NW 11th and is by pay-what-you-will donation, supported by Elders from Friendly House, Summerplace, Terwilliger Plaza, Augustana Church, Loaves and Fishes, Hollywood Senior Center and Elders in Action

Defend free speech & the right to organize!  Protest FBI and Grand Jury Repression!      Join the National Day of Action today at 5.30pm in front of the Federal Building in Downtown Portland.  Protests are being called across the country in solidarity against activists who have been targeted by the FBI to repress anti-war and international solidarity activists.  In December 2010, under the direction of U.S. Attorney Patrick Fitzgerald the FBI delivered nine new subpoenas in Chicago to anti-war and Palestine solidarity activists.  Three women from Minneapolis have even faced re-activated subpoenas. They are all standing strong in refusing to appear.

Van Jones, former Green Jobs Advisor in the Obama White House, will be giving a free presentation on CREATING A CLEAN ENERGY ECONOMY at a quarter to 6pm tonight in the White Stag Building, University of Oregon Extension.
70 NW Couch St
Van Jones is a globally recognized, award-winning pioneer in human rights and the clean-energy economy. He is a co-founder of three successful non-profit organizations: the Ella Baker Center for Human Rights, Color of Change, and Green For All. Van is currently a senior fellow at the Center For American Progress and is a senior policy advisor at Green For All

At 7pm tonight in the First Unitarian Church in Downtown Portland there will be a COMMUNITY FORUM for people to stand up to Citizens United, when One year ago, the US Supreme Court ruled that unlimited amounts of money form corporate coffers could be directly used in elections with almost no disclosure of its sources.   In the 2010 elections, corporate funds poured into congressional races, enabling the Republicans to purchase a majority in the U.S. House of Representatives. Democracy is government of, by, and for the people.  Now the US Supreme Court has given us government of, by, and for corporations. What does this mean for democracy and what can we do about it?  Dan Meek, Public Interest Attorney, campaign finance reform advocate, and Barbara Dudley, former Executive Director of the National Lawyers Guild and head of the Oregon Working Families Party, will be speaking. Sponsored by Alliance for Democracy, Co-sponsored by the Economic Justice Action Group of the 1st Unitarian Church, Women's International League for Peace and Freedom, Independent Party of Oregon, Progressive Party of Oregon, Oregon Working Families Party.
